Quality Time to Hire Cost per Hire

Active Sourcing & Talent Pools Achieve Measurable Results

Page 6

Cost per Hire and Time to Hire can be dramatically decreased through Active Sourcing and Talent Pool Management. Moreover, a high quality of newcomers can be assured more easily.

Winter 2012

Source: IntraWorlds, Experiences with customer projects

A selection & evaluation of the talents in the Talent Pool is already in existence

Candidates qualification and their aptitude are far better evaluated by exiting contacts with talents (workshops, etc.)

Ensuring quality of candidates for job positions

Talent Pools allow direct access and fast address of suitable talents

Lengthy detours over job advertisement, headhunters, and marketing campaigns are averted

Reducing Time to Hire by up to 50%

Expenses for managing talents in the Talent Pool are far lower than for establishing contacts to new applicants

Higher rate of newcomers from the Talent Pool means lower recruiting-costs per talent

Reducing Cost per Hire by up to 30%

Module Correspondences – Feature Overview

Winter 2012 Page 12

Source: IntraWorlds

The correspondence module allows archiving all communication with users and additionally tracks opening and bounce information for email communication.

Archiving of messages to users (including email-to-IntraWorlds feature) Opening & bounce information for messages & newsletters

Tasks with details and status Tasks assignable to users and admins Different task overviews

Correspondence and tasks overview and history per user Detailed view of correspondences
